Modularization Manager
Microsoft Cloud Operations and Innovation (CO+I) is the team behind the cloud, and they are seeking a Modularization Manager to help build the cloud datacenters that power the world’s largest online services. The Modularization Manager will lead the datacenter modularization program, engage with stakeholders, and manage multiple global projects to deliver innovative modular solutions.

The Modularization Manager will provide design support for projects at Site Due Diligence, Site Master planning and throughout Detailed Design through construction to handover. The role will provide technical direction, and the facilitation and delivery of Microsoft’s industry-leading datacenter designs
This role will require collaboration with Global Technical Excellence team, Global Strategy teams and DCE Operations Team to develop the datacenter designs from basis of design (BOD) to issue for constructions (IFC) and through the Construction Administration phase of datacenter until handover for new DC project build-outs
To be successful in this role the candidate will collaborate with internal & external customers, direct the technical delivery of multiple, concurrent, complete Datacenter design solutions aligned with the scopes, schedules and budgets of the projects
The candidate will be able to utilize experience on past modularization projects to affect traditional execution to a modularization execution
Collaborate with the Site Selection, Operations, Security, and Design team to develop data center (DC) designs, starting from project conception to issue for construction (IFC) for new DC projects build outs and major infrastructure upgrades
The candidate will also potentially act and design manager/program manager of the module component of any particular project
Provide methodology execution to ensure that engineering teams receive feedback on what is required in design for successful module fabrication
Coordinate with transportation contractors to ensure that critical aspects like lifting, handling, and installation are addressed and insured
Develop, budget and assess staffing plans for success execution and quality performance
Align any and all module yard operations to the overall project scope
Progress reporting – ensure that the MS team is well aware of the progress being made in the fabrication yard
Coordinate a team of engineers, fabricators, constructors and project control teams to deliver datacenter modular solutions aligned with the defined scope, schedule, and budget of the program objectives
Possess a high level of proficiency in commercial and industrial modularization solutions with a primary focus on datacenter or equivalent high-tech designs
Deliver modular solutions for datacenter buildings, power systems, cooling schemes, telecom, and controls infrastructure to align with Microsoft Corporation datacenter engineering standards
Develop feasibility studies by partnering with Microsoft management peers specific to the concept, business objectives, opportunities, risks, mitigations, key result metrics and timing
Develop program strategic execution plans inclusive of cost, procurement, delivery strategy and schedule integration for review and approval
Drive conceptual engineering and manufacturing development in support of modular delivery. This includes LLE procurement planning, cost team estimate development and funding plans, manufacturing quality control processes, offsite commissioning, safety in design improvements and end to end integration planning
Participate in Module Fabrication Yard due diligence visits to evaluate capabilities and subsequent request for proposal development, bidding and awards
Beginning with the end in mind, ensure modularization concepts are integrated and aligned with project specific detailed engineering and design packages for construction
